I'm in the mood for a "Misty Breeze" 1 Captain MorganŽ Parrot Bay mango rum 1 vodka 2 Pine-orange-banana juice 1 Maraschino cherry 2 SpriteŽ soda First had that one at Outback Steak House! They are terrific! Not very Christmasy I know, but if one of those got left out for Santa i'm sure he'd love it!

T.M.I.!!! ;o) Someone please get me a "Rookie Magic"~ A couple scoops of vanilla ice cream Couple of oreo cookies some chocolate-flavoured Nestle's Quick powder some 2% milk (DON'T try to cut it with 1%!! Trust me...) Beat it all up in the blender. Beat it up GOOD. Beat it to the point the cookie and the ice cream are too incapacitated to press charges of assault. Then dump it all into a glass. And then spray some Ready-Whip on top......tastes like they make at that certain loud restaurant that serves overpriced burnt hamburgers and advertises itself with that ridiculous-looking cartoon bird........... If you really want a nice roarin' stomachache, cut it with heavy whipping cream instead of 2%. I don't know what the original recipe for it is but this is my own "reverse-engineered" version and it tastes surprisingly like the real thing. Try it out sometime.

Eggnog is the devil's drink. BLECH. That said: Jubelale a long standing Christmas tradition in my world. This year's batch one of the best in 4 or 5 years. Also like to make my own version of a Irish coffee: Bailey's, coffee, 1/2 and 1/2, a splash of Irish whiskey and whipped cream on top. Nummy.
